I'm trying to use the create-a-subclass feature on the site to create a monastic tradition that uses Way of the Four Elements as a template.
I'm a first time user, and I'm having trouble filling it in.
With several options (or features?) available at featured levels, do I create each one of those as a feature, or as a class feature option?
example:
at third level, choose two Focus and one Ritual from the following : Focus1, Focus2, Focus3, Focus4, Ritual1, Ritual 2, Ritual3
At sixth level, choose an additional Focus and additional ritual: Focus5, Focus6, Focus7, Ritual4, Ritual5
At 11th level, choose an additional Focus and additional ritual: Focus8, Focus9, FOcus10, Ritual6
At 17th level, choose an additional Focus and additional ritual: Focus11, Focus12, Focus13, Ritual7
Like WotFE, unchosen options from previous levels are available at each featured level. Focus powers emulate spells with instant effects, rituals emulate spells with extended durations.
I'm just not sure how to punch that all into the subclass creator! I've tried and it isn't shareable due to reasons.
Any suggestions? If I wanted to add WotFE into the creator, how would I do it? That would work for my homebrew.
To load WotFE in as the subclass from which you are starting, you have to buy either the subclass, or the PHB from this website.
When you put in each Feature, you enter each option individually and then enter at which levels they get to choose. But it can get wonky when you list spells as options if they homebrew it won’t allow it.
I've managed to get it "shareable" by repeating the feature at each Feature Level (so you get the same feature at 3,6,11,17) and adding the different options at the requisite levels.
